In a modern review, we described the identification as well as the characterization of a new atypical opioid receptor with exclusive unfavorable regulatory Qualities towards opioid peptides.1 Our success confirmed that ACKR3/CXCR7, hitherto often known as an atypical scavenger receptor for chemokines CXCL12 and CXCL11, can also be a wide-spectrum scavenger for opioid peptides from the enkephalin, dynorphin, and nociceptin people, regulating their availability for classical opioid receptors.
These effects propose that conolidine is ready to restrict the ACKR3 receptor’s damaging regulatory properties and liberate opioid peptides, enabling them to bind on the classical opioid receptors and market analgesic exercise.
Whilst the opiate receptor depends on G protein coupling for signal transduction, this receptor was discovered to make use of arrestin activation for internalization with the receptor. If not, the receptor promoted no other signaling cascades (59) Modifications of conolidine have resulted in variable advancement in binding efficacy. This binding finally amplified endogenous opioid peptide concentrations, raising binding to opiate receptors along with the connected ache aid.

Study on conolidine is limited, though the number of experiments available clearly show which the drug retains promise as a doable opiate-like therapeutic for Long-term ache. Conolidine was 1st synthesized in 2011 as Element of a examine by Tarselli et al. (60) The first de novo pathway to synthetic manufacturing located that their synthesized form served as effective analgesics in opposition to Serious, persistent soreness within an in-vivo design (sixty). A biphasic ache design was utilized, where formalin Remedy is injected right into a rodent’s paw. This results in a Most important soreness reaction instantly adhering to injection as well as a secondary suffering response twenty - 40 minutes following injection (sixty two).

Elucidating the exact pharmacological system of action (MOA) of The natural way taking place compounds may be demanding. Whilst Tarselli et al. (sixty) formulated the main de novo artificial pathway to conolidine and showcased that this In a natural way transpiring compound correctly suppresses responses to both chemically induced and inflammation-derived agony, the pharmacologic target chargeable for its antinociceptive motion remained elusive. Offered the difficulties affiliated with standard pharmacological and physiological methods, click here Mendis et al. used cultured neuronal networks grown on multi-electrode array (MEA) technological innovation coupled with pattern matching reaction profiles to deliver a potential MOA of conolidine (61).
